You know, in the last few years, making sure that commercial spaces have safe and effective exit solutions has really become a big deal. Just look at how panic bars have changed! Nowadays, they’re not just about pushing a bar; they’ve got smart features that totally change the game. For starters, there are these cool automatic locking systems that kick in as soon as you press the panic bar. It’s all about keeping things secure while still making it easy to get out when emergencies happen. Plus, tons of these modern panic bars come loaded with sensor tech that can actually spot if someone’s tampering with them or trying to break in. That means security personnel get real-time alerts—super handy, right?
And let's not forget about digital connectivity—it's kind of a big deal too. A lot of panic bars are now coming with features that let you keep tabs on them remotely through smartphone apps. Can you believe it? Facility managers can get updates on the status of their panic bars, check if they’re working properly, and make sure they're following safety rules, all from their phone! This is especially important in busy spots like schools or hospitals where safety is really critical. Region | Market Share (%) | Growth Rate (CAGR %) | Key Trends |
---|---|---|---|
North America | 30% | 5.2% | Smart technology integration, regulatory compliance |
Europe | 28% | 4.8% | Sustainability focus, enhanced safety standards |
Asia Pacific | 25% | 6.1% | Rapid urbanization, increasing safety awareness |
Latin America | 10% | 3.5% | Emerging market potential, investment in infrastructure |
Middle East & Africa | 7% | 4.0% | Security concerns, government initiatives |
You know, the way panic bar technology has been evolving is really changing the game for security. I mean, they've come up with some pretty cool materials that make these things more durable and functional than ever. Recently, we’ve seen a push for lightweight but super tough components that can handle a lot of wear and tear. This means panic bars can be relied on when it really matters, which is a huge plus. Manufacturers are now getting crafty with advanced composites and alloys. Not only do these materials lighten the load, but they’re also tough against corrosion and impacts, which is perfect for places that see a lot of traffic.
And it's not just the materials that are getting an upgrade; the designs of panic bars are also changing a lot. Engineers are paying more attention to ergonomics these days, making sure that these bars are functional and easy to use. That’s especially crucial in emergencies when every second counts. They’re adding better grip textures and more intuitive mechanisms to help people make a quick escape. It’s all about peace of mind for buildings that take safety seriously.
